To register, file a Business Registration Application (Form NJ-REG) online with the Division of Revenue and Enterprise Services. Once registered, you will receive a New Jersey Business Registration Certificate and, if applicable, a New Jersey Certificate of Authority (to be able to collect Sales Tax).
How do I start a sole proprietorship in NJ?
To establish a sole proprietorship in New Jersey, here’s everything you need to know.
- Choose a business name.
- File a trade name with the county clerk’s office.
- Obtain licenses, permits, and zoning clearance.
- Obtain an Employer Identification Number.

What do you need to start a business in New Jersey?
Business Licenses – Business registration is required for any business operating in the State of New Jersey by filing Form NJ-REG. Sales Tax Certificate – Businesses selling products and certain services will need to register for a Sales Tax Certificate with the New Jersey Department of the Treasury.

How to collect sales tax in New Jersey?
If you have indicated on your Application for Business Registration that you will be collecting sales tax, remitting use tax, or using New Jersey Exemption Certificates, the State of New Jersey will send you a New Jersey Certificate of Authority for sales tax.
